▶Single nucleotide polymorphisms of CYP19A1 predict clinical outcomes and adverse events associated with letrozole in patients with metastatic breast cancerAssociationN=109In Hae Park et al.(2011)· Cancer Chemotherapy and Pharmacology
A pharmacogenetic study of 109 Korean patients with hormone receptor-positive metastatic breast cancer treated with letrozole found that three CYP19A1 SNP variants (rs700518, rs10459592, rs4775936) were associated with improved clinical benefit rate (OR = 2.45-2.61, P = 0.025-0.036). Haplotype analysis showed specific haplotypes M_1_3 and M_2_1 were strongly associated with better response (OR = 3.37-5.33) and improved time to progression, suggesting CYP19A1 polymorphisms may serve as predictive markers for aromatase inhibitor efficacy.
About CYP19A1
This gene encodes a member of the cytochrome P450 superfamily of enzymes. The cytochrome P450 proteins are monooxygenases which catalyze many reactions involved in drug metabolism and synthesis of cholesterol, steroids and other lipids. This protein localizes to the endoplasmic reticulum and catalyzes the last steps of estrogen biosynthesis. Mutations in this gene can result in either increased or decreased aromatase activity; the associated phenotypes suggest that estrogen functions both as a sex steroid hormone and in growth or differentiation. Alternative promoter use and alternative splicing results in multiple transcript variants that have different tissue specificities. [provided by RefSeq, Dec 2016]
